1. Violation of tightness: why the refrigerator door allows warm air to pass through

The most common cause of icing is constant supply of warm air from the outside. The refrigerator is forced to compensate for the increase in temperature by working in increased mode. Humidity from the air condenses on the back wall and freezes.

How to check the tightness:

  • 📏 Test with a sheet of paper: place a sheet between the door and the body. If it falls out or is easily pulled out, the seal is worn out.
  • 🔦 Visual inspection: cracks, deformations or dirt on the rubber seal disrupt the fit.
  • 💡 Checking the hinge: a skewed door (for example, due to weakened hinges) also allows air to pass through.

If the seal is damaged, it can be restore (for example, warmed up with a hairdryer to restore elasticity) or replaced. The cost of new tires for popular models (Atlant, Beko) is from 800 to 2500 rubles.

2. Wrong temperature: why setting the thermostat leads to icing

The optimal temperature in the main chamber of the refrigerator is +4…+5°C. If you set the value lower +2°C, the compressor will work almost without stopping, and the rear wall will become covered with ice. Particularly relevant for models with drip defrosting system (Indesit, Ariston).

How to check and correct:

  1. Make sure that the thermostat has not gone wrong accidentally (for example, when moving or cleaning).
  2. Use external thermometer to check the real temperature (the built-in sensor can lie).
  3. If the refrigerator with electronic control (Samsung RB30J3000WW, LG GA-B489YDQL, reset the settings to factory settings (Settings → Reset).

⚠️ Attention: In refrigerators with No Frost ice on the back wall may indicate a breakdown of sensor defrost or defrost timerIn this case, diagnostics by a specialist is required.

3. Overloading the chambers: how improper placement of products causes ice.

A refrigerator is not a warehouse! If you fill it to capacity, it is disrupted the circulation of cold air. It is especially critical:

  • 🥩 Hot products: the steam from them settles on the walls and freezes.
  • 🥤 Open liquids: evaporation increases the humidity in the chamber.
  • 🧊 Products close to the back wall: block the operation of the evaporator.

4. Failure of the thermostat or temperature sensor

If the back wall is frozen, but the door closes tightly and the temperature is set correctly, it is the fault thermostat (in mechanical models) or temperature sensor (in electronic ones). These parts are responsible for turning the compressor on/off. If the refrigerator breaks down, either does not turn off at allor it works chaotically.

Signs of a malfunctioning thermostat:

  • 🔊 The compressor works non-stop (it hums constantly).
  • ❄️ There is ice on the back wall, and there is a snow “coat” in the freezer.
  • 🌡️ The temperature in the chamber is below +2°C, despite the settings.

How to check the thermostat:

  1. Disconnect the refrigerator from the power supply.
  2. Remove the protective casing (in mechanical models it is usually located inside the chamber).
  3. Test the thermostat with a multimeter in the resistance test mode. At room temperature, the resistance should be. 0 Ohm (closed), when cooling (for example, with ice) - (open).

⚠️ Attention: In electronically controlled refrigerators (Bosch KGE39XW2AR, Liebherr CPes 4066), the temperature sensor is often built into the board. It is replaced. requires soldering and skills in working with electronics - it is better to entrust the repair to a specialist.

5. Clogged drainage system: why the water does not drain and freezes

In refrigerators with drip defrosting system condensation flows down the back wall into the drainage hole and is discharged into a special tank. If the hole or tube is clogged, water accumulates and freezes, forming an ice crust.

6. Freon leak or compressor breakdown

If none of the previous reasons are suitable, and ice on the back wall continues to grow, it is possible refrigerant (freon) leak or compressor wear. These breakdowns require professional repairs, but they can be diagnosed independently.

Signs of a freon leak:

  • 🔊 The compressor works, but does not cool (or cools poorly).
  • ❄️ Ice forms only in one corner of the rear wall (usually where the evaporator is located).
  • 💰 Electricity consumption has increased by 1.5-2 times.

Signs of a compressor malfunction:

  • 🔊 Loud knocking or vibration during operation.
  • 🔥 The compressor housing is hot (above +60°C).
  • 📉 The refrigerator does not turn off or turns off too rarely.

⚠️ Attention: Independent repair of the compressor or refilling freon prohibited is a job for certified craftsmen. Contact the service center, indicating the model of the refrigerator (located on the nameplate on the back or inside the chamber).

How much does the repair cost?

The cost of refilling freon is from 2500 rubles, compressor replacement - from 5,000 to 12,000 rubles (depending on the model). For refrigerators older than 10 years, repairs may be unprofitable - it is cheaper to buy a new one.

7. External factors: humidity, room temperature, power surges

Sometimes icing of the back wall is caused not by a breakdown, but by external conditions:

  • 🌧️ High indoor humidity (above 70%). This is especially true for kitchens without a hood or during the rainy season.
  • 🔥 Heat in the room (above +30°C). The refrigerator does not have time to remove heat, the compressor is working at its limit.
  • Power surges. Lead to malfunctions of electronic boards (in models Samsung, LG with a display).

How to minimize the influence of external factors:

  • 📌 Install voltage stabilizer (for example, Resanta ACH-1000/1-C).
  • 📌 Check the ventilation around the refrigerator - the distance to the walls should be at least 5 cm.
  • 📌 Use moisture absorber (for example, silica gel) inside the chamber.

What to do right now: a step-by-step action plan

If you find ice on the back wall, follow the algorithm:

  1. Defrost the refrigerator (unplug, leave the door open for 12-24 hours).
  2. Check the seal and seal the door.
  3. Adjust the temperature at +4...+5°C.
  4. Clean the drainage hole.
  5. Check the operation of the compressor (should be turned off periodically).
  6. Inspect the back wall for cracks or damage to the evaporator.

If, after defrosting and cleaning, ice appears again within 1-2 weeks, contact the service center.

FAQ: Frequently asked questions about ice on the back wall of the refrigerator

Can I use the refrigerator if the back wall is frozen?

Yes, but undesirably for a long time. The ice crust causes the compressor to wear out, which leads to increased energy consumption and the risk of breakdown. In addition, the temperature in the chamber may become unstable, and the products may freeze or spoil faster.

Why does ice appear only in one corner of the rear wall?

This is a typical symptom freon leaks or damage. evaporator in a specific place. This also happens when clogged drainageif water flows to only one point and freezes. A technician needs to diagnose.

How often do you need to defrost a refrigerator with No Frost?

Manufacturers claim that refrigerators No Frost do not need to be defrosted. However, in practice it is recommended to do so. removes ice from the evaporator and extends the service life of the equipment. preventive defrosting once a year - this removes ice from the evaporator and extends the service life of the equipment.

Can ice on the back wall be due to poor-quality electricity?

Yes. Voltage surges or too low voltage (below 190 V) interfere with the operation of the compressor. and electronic boards. This leads to unstable cooling and icing. The solution is to install voltage stabilizer.
